Supplier Information
Zhejiang Leibeisi Radiator Co., Ltd.
Radiator for Renault Clio Oem. : 8200735038
After Market
Zhejiang, China (Mainland)
Negotiable Trial Order
contact supplierSupplier Information
Radiator for Renault Clio Oem. : 8200735038
After Market
Zhejiang, China (Mainland)
Negotiable Trial Order
contact supplier